BARBECUED MEATBALLS



Barbecued Meatballs image

Enjoy these meatballs in a wonderfully tangy sauce! Use your favorite flavor of barbecue sauce. When the meatballs are done, you can place them in a slow cooker/server to keep them warm.

Provided by AZTHESPIAN

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Meat and Poultry     Meatball Appetizer Recipes

Time 1h20m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 pounds ground beef
1 ½ cups fresh bread crumbs
¼ cup chopped onion
½ cup milk
1 ½ teaspoons salt
2 eggs
1 (18 ounce) bottle barbecue sauce

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  • In a large bowl, combine the beef, bread, onion, milk, salt and eggs. Shape into little meatballs, about 1 inch in size. Place the meatballs into a 9x13 inch baking dish.
  • Bake at 375 degrees F (190 degrees C) for 25 to 30 minutes. Pour barbecue sauce over the meatballs and bake for 35 more minutes.

BARBECUE MEATBALLS AND VEGETABLES



Barbecue Meatballs and Vegetables image

Meatballs made with BBQ sauce and a touch of honey are skillet-cooked to perfection and served with a yummy mélange of vegetables-and pineapple chunks.

Provided by My Food and Family

Categories     Recipes

Time 50m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15

1/2 cup MIRACLE WHIP Dressing
1/2 cup KRAFT Original Barbecue Sauce
1/4 cup honey
1 Tbsp. chili powder, divided
1 tsp. ground black pepper, divided
1 tsp. ground red pepper (cayenne), divided
1 tsp. salt, divided
1 lb. ground beef
1 medium green pepper, cut into chunks
1 medium onion, sliced
1 cup sliced mushrooms
1 cup sliced yellow squash
1 cup sliced zucchini
1 can (8 oz.) pineapple chunks, drained
2 Tbsp. ch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Combine dressing, barbecue sauce, honey, 2 tsp. of the chili powder and 1/2 tsp. each of the ground black pepper, red pepper and salt. Set aside.
  • Mix meat, remaining 1 tsp. chili powder and remaining 1/2 tsp. each of the black pepper, red pepper and salt. Shape into 12 meatballs. Brown meatballs in large skillet on medium-high heat; drain. Set aside. In same skillet, cook and stir green pepper, onion, mushrooms, squash, zucchini and pineapple on medium heat 5 minutes. Reduce heat to low.
  • Stir in reserved dressing mixture and the meatballs; cover. Simmer 15 minutes, stirring occasionally. Stir in parsley.

BARBECUE MEATBALLS



Barbecue Meatballs image

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h35m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 20

2 cups barbecue sauce
2 tablespoons white vinegar
1 tablespoon loosely packed brown sugar
1 teaspoon hot sauce
1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
One 25-count bag All-Purpose Meatballs (still frozen is fine), recipe follows
Mashed potatoes, for serving
Chopped fresh parsley, for serving
Green salad, for serving
5 pounds ground beef
1 1/2 cups plain breadcrumbs
1/2 cup milk
1/4 cup heavy cream
1/4 cup ch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
2 tablespoons grainy mustard
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es
4 large eggs
2 tablespoons olive oil

Steps:

  • In a large skillet over medium-high heat, add the barbecue sauce, vinegar, brown sugar, hot sauce and Worcestershire and bring to a boil. Add the All-Purpose Meatballs and bring to a simmer. Cover and cook until the meatballs are heated through, 8 to 10 minutes.
  • Spoon over mashed potatoes and sprinkle with parsley. Serve with a green salad.
  • To make the meatballs, combine the ground beef, breadcrumbs, milk, cream, parsley, mustard, salt, black pepper, red pepper flakes and eggs in a large mixing bowl. Mix together well with your hands. Scoop out 1-tablespoon portions and roll them into balls with your hands. Place the meatballs onto parchment-lined baking sheets and put the baking sheets in the freezer for 5 to 10 minutes for the meatballs to firm up.
  • To brown the meatballs, heat the olive oil in a heavy pot or large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the meatballs in batches, making sure not to overcrowd the pot. Cook, turning the meatballs to make sure they brown all over, 5 to 7 minutes per batch. Drain on paper towels.
  • Freezer instructions: Put the cooked meatballs in a single layer on baking sheets and put into the freezer. When frozen, divide them into freezer bags, 25 per bag, and return them to the freezer. Yield: 125 meatballs.

MEATBALLS IN BARBECUE SAUCE



Meatballs in Barbecue Sauce image

This recipe came from my home ec teacher in high school. I enjoy making it because you can throw it in the oven and still have time to do other things.-Yvonne Nave, Lyons, Kansas

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ers     Dinner

Time 50m

Yield about 4 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 large egg, lightly beaten
1 can (5 ounces) evaporated milk
1 cup quick-cooking oats
1/2 cup finely chopped onion
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on chili powder
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1-1/2 pounds ground beef
SAUCE:
1 cup ketchup
3/4 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 cup chopped onion
1/2 teaspoon Liquid Smoke, optional
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the first eight ingredients. Crumble beef over mixture and mix well. Shape into 1-in. balls. , Place meatballs on a greased rack in a shallow baking pan.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 18-20 minutes or until meat is no longer pink; drain. , Meanwhile, combine the sauce ingredients in a saucepan.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er for 2 minutes, stirring frequently. Pour over meatballs. Bake 10-12 minutes longer.

BARBECUE MEATBALLS



Barbecue Meatballs image

I came across this recipe while living abroad many years ago. These meatballs are as finger-licking good as barbecued ribs but easier to eat.-Dane Harvill, Mosca, Colorado

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 1h10m

Yield 6-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 18

2 eggs
1/2 cup evaporated milk
1 cup dry bread crumbs
1 small onion, chopped
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
2 pounds ground beef
SAUCE:
1-1/2 cups water
2/3 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 cup chili sauce
3 tablespoons cider vinegar
3 tablespoons soy sauce
2 tablespoons ketchup
1-1/2 teaspoons ground ginger
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per
Dash Worcestershire sauce

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the first six ingredients. Crumble beef over mixture and mix well. With wet hands, shape into 1-in. balls. In a large skillet, brown meatballs in small batches over medium heat, turning often. Remove with a slotted spoon and keep warm; drain. , In the same pan, combine sauce ingredients. Bring to a boil over medium heat. Reduce heat; add the meatballs. Simmer, uncovered, for 30 minutes or until sauce is absorbed.

SHEET PAN BARBECUE MEATBALLS



Sheet Pan Barbecue Meatballs image

If you're a fan of cocktail meatballs, chances are you're familiar with the famous slow cooker recipe starring frozen meatballs, chili sauce, and grape jelly. It has a devoted following online and in real life and became a fixture at my family's birthday celebrations as a crowd-friendly snack adored by all ages. I've swapped the slow cooker for a sheet pan, which allows you to enjoy meatballs from scratch in minutes, rather than hours. Orange soda lends a citrusy, sweet-and-sour-esque taste to the quick-fix barbecue sauce. Shape the meatballs into smaller sizes for snacking or go big to turn this appetizer into the main event.

Provided by Kelly Senyei

Categories     side-dish

Time 30m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 21

Cooking spray
2 slices white bread
1/2 cup dairy or non-dairy milk
1 pound ground beef
1/2 pound ground pork
1 large egg
1/4 cup minced scallions (2 scallions)
2 1/2 teaspoons garlic powder
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1 cup orange soda
1/2 cup ketchup
1/3 cup packed light brown sugar
3 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
2 teaspoons cornstarch
1 tablespoon water

Steps:

  • Make the meatballs.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Line a baking sheet with foil, then grease the foil with cooking spray.
  • In a large bowl, combine the bread and milk and let sit until the bread has absorbed the milk, about 5 minutes. Mash it all together with a fork. Add the ground beef, ground pork, egg, scallions, gar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Using your hands, mix together just until combined.
  • Scoop out 2-tablespoon portions of the mixture and roll into balls. Arrange the meatballs in a single layer on the baking sheet. Bake the meatballs for about 15 minutes, until golden brown and cooked through. (Larger meatballs will require longer cooking times.) While the meatballs are baking, make the barbecue sauce.
  • Make the barbecue sauce. In a medium saucepan, whisk together the orange soda, ketchup, brown sugar, vinegar, Worcestershire, garlic powder, smoked paprika, salt, and pepper. Bring to a boil over medium heat.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together the cornstarch and water.
  • When the soda mixture comes to a boil, whisk in the cornstarch slurry. Boil the sauce, stirring occasionally, until it thickens to the consistency of syrup, 3 to 5 minutes. Remove from the heat and set the sauce aside to cool for 10 minutes.
  • Remove the meatballs from the oven, then transfer to a large bowl. Pour in the barbecue sauce, toss to combine, and serve.
